Outrig项目v0.7.3版本发布:增强监控稳定性与用户体验优化
Outrig是一个现代化的开发工具集,旨在为开发者提供高效的本地开发环境管理能力。该项目通过简洁的界面和强大的功能,帮助开发者轻松管理容器、监控系统资源以及自动化常见开发任务。最新发布的v0.7.3版本在监控稳定性和用户体验方面进行了多项重要改进。
核心功能增强
本次版本最显著的改进是对监控功能的稳定性提升。开发团队实现了watch pinning机制,这一创新设计确保了监控任务能够持久化运行,不会因为系统资源波动或其他因素而意外终止。具体来说:
-
监控任务持久化:现在监控任务会通过名称而非编号进行固定,这种设计更加健壮,避免了因编号变动导致的监控失效问题。
-
goroutine管理优化:虽然暂时移除了goroutine级别的固定功能,但团队已经为未来的进一步优化奠定了基础。
用户体验改进
在用户界面和交互方面,v0.7.3版本也带来了多项优化:
-
首页滚动修复:解决了首页滚动条异常的问题,使页面浏览更加流畅自然。
-
集成指引优化:重新调整了集成说明的布局位置,使其更加醒目易找,帮助新用户更快上手。
-
更新机制改进:增强了更新器的激活频率,确保当用户手动启动更新或系统检测到可用更新时,更新器能够保持在最前台,避免被其他应用窗口遮挡。
系统稳定性提升
开发团队对系统底层也进行了多项优化:
-
进程管理增强:当执行完全终止操作时,系统现在会彻底关闭更新器进程,避免残留进程占用系统资源。
-
后台模式移除:从Outrigapp更新器中移除了后台运行模式,这一改变简化了进程管理,减少了潜在的系统冲突。
依赖项更新
作为常规维护的一部分,项目也更新了多项依赖:
- 将lucide-react从0.511.0升级至0.513.0版本
- 更新了ESLint相关依赖组
这些依赖更新不仅带来了性能改进,也修复了已知的问题,进一步提升了整个项目的稳定性和安全性。
总结
Outrig v0.7.3版本虽然是一个小版本更新,但在监控稳定性和用户体验方面的改进却意义重大。通过引入watch pinning机制和优化更新流程,开发团队展现了对系统可靠性和用户友好性的持续关注。这些改进使得Outrig作为一个开发工具更加成熟可靠,能够更好地服务于开发者的日常需求。对于现有用户来说,升级到这个版本将获得更稳定、更流畅的使用体验。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



